The birth of designer handbags

Bags are a portable canvas that showcases the artist's work. Designer handbags were not popular until the 20th century. Our ancestors' first possessions were animal skin and plant fibre bags. Designer bags are symbols of status and luxury, so it's no wonder that they're sought-after.

The modern designer handbag dates back to the 1920s, when designers started to promote their products and establish themselves as labels in their own right. Coco Chanel revolutionized the handbag industry with her iconic 2.55 bag. It was an intricate pattern of quilting and a chain strap. The bag introduced women to the idea of shopping with hands free and revolutionized the fashion industry.

Before the invention of the handbag, travellers were required to carry heavy pieces of luggage. Luggage designers like Louis Vuitton fashioned smaller bags that snapped shut which made them ideal for keeping papers, tickets and money. The bags that resulted were referred to as portmanteau bags and they became hugely popular.

As the handbags became more sought-after as designers began to design bags. Grace Kelly, who married Prince Rainier in 1956, brought Hermes designer bags to the forefront. Her Hermes Birkin bag is a fashion staple today.

After World War II women's fashion styles changed dramatically. The waist was trimmed, and skirts that were full reached the ankles. Fashion houses began to design smaller, more structured bags made of swirling transparent lucite, marbling, and pearlescent materials to complement the new look. Colour co-ordination was key in the glam 1950s style and women would frequently amass a collection of coordinating bags to match their hats, shoes and clothing.

The first designer handbags made of leather

Designer bags have been a must-have for women however, they began as accessories for men. The term "handbag" was actually first used in 1900 to describe luggage that resembled today's briefcases and even as early as Ancient Egypt hieroglyphs depict men carrying bags on their waists. It was not until the 1920s that handbags came into their own as a woman's fashion accessory and designers began to offer more variety in designs materials, onlinedesignerhandbags colors, and materials.

Coco Chanel revolutionized bags for fashion by introducing her quilted leather 2.55 design. It was the first bag to have straps that allowed women to have hands-free and without the hassle of a uncomfortable top handle. This gave women greater freedom and comfort while walking, dancing or just going out to the town.

In the early 1960s Judith Leiber founded her New York-based label, and became famous for onlinedesignerhandbags her evening bags that were adorned in rhinestone. Her designs were so well-loved that they were an essential part of the wardrobes of women everywhere, and were also worn by actors and singers.

Hermes is another fashion house that has its roots in equestrian equipment but started to take off in the 1950s, when Grace Kelly wore her Birkin bag while engaged to Prince Rainier of Monaco. Hermes is known for its luxury leather bags that are designed with function and fashion in both mind.

The first designer handbags were created of silk

As fashions evolved as did the need for a space to store personal items. The first European women carried small pouches to carry coins alms, and other religious objects in their pockets or on dresses. Later, women used handbags as a way to show their status and to convey their own unique style. Portraits from the 1700s depict women carrying what can be described as the first designer handbags, typically affixed to their dresses with string tasseled.

Designers began creating bags of a variety of shapes and materials after the 1900s. Some were embellished with flowers, lace, and beads. Others were constructed with metallic and leather. Some bags had removable compartments that could be used to store a fan gloves, or other things. In the 1920s, the styles of handbags became more feminine, and a lot of them had Egyptian influences.
